Massive fire breaks out at London high rise
London, June 14 (IBNS): A massive fire broke out at a tower block in London on Wednesday, officials said.
As per London Fire Brigade, forty fire engines and over 200 firefighters are fighting to bring the fire under control.
"The Brigade has received multiple calls. The fire is from the second floor to the top floor of the 27 floor building," the London Fire Brigade posted on Facebook.
Fire crews from North Kensington, Kensington, Hammersmith and Paddington and from surrounding fire stations are in attendance.
The cause of the fire is not known at this stage, the London Fire Brigade said.
Several people have been injured.
Evacuation processes going on.
"Residents continue to be evacuated from the tower block fire in #NorthKensington. A number of people being treated for a range of injuries," the Metropolitan Police tweeted.
